Section 746.4507 - Must I have a telephone at my child-care center?

Universal Citation: 26 TX Admin Code § 746.4507

Current through Reg. 50, No. 13; March 28, 2025

Yes. You must have:

(1) A telephone at your child-care center with a listed telephone number; or

(2) Access to a telephone located in the same building for use in an emergency and where a person is available to:

(A) Receive incoming calls to the child-care center;

(B) Immediately transmit messages regarding children in care to child-care center caregivers; and

(C) Make outgoing calls for the child-care center as necessary.
